Miley Cyrus is getting sappy with an adorable birthday message to her new husband, Liam Hemsworth.

Posting a long, but sweet, tribute to her new "hubz" on IG, Miley goes into great detail about their relationship, spilling cute everyday routines that make it clear why they fit together.

"L, HBD to my #1 ... When we met you were 19, Today, you are 29 ... I thought I could share some of my favorite things about my favorite dude in honor of this very special day," she began her message.

When we said it's a long message, we meant it. Here's some of our favorite things Miley said about Liam:

  • "The way you look at me , The way you look at our dogs ... our pigs , our horses , our cats , our fish. The way you look at your family .... Your friends .... At Strangers .... At Life."

  • "I love your dirty socks on the floor cause that means YOU'RE HOME."

  • "I love laying in bed late at night looking for new recipes, only going to sleep so we can wake up and make breakfast together while having a hot cup of coffee. (almost as hot as you are ?)

  • "I love going to a party and remembering basically everyone is fake AF out here and how lucky I am to share a life with someone so REAL."

  • "I even love when you shrink my favorite t-shirt in the dryer - because having a boyfriend (oh em gee I almost forgot you're my friggen husband now) that does laundry is pretty much the best thing ever."

You get the drift.

Miley then ends the message proclaiming, "I'm proud of the person you have become and look forward to all the good we will contribute ToGeThEr in the future. You and Me baby ..... let's take this dark place head on and shrine thru with the light of L.O.V.E"

As The Blast reported, Liam and Miley got married during an intimate surprise ceremony in Tennessee right after Christmas. Their wedding came just weeks after losing their Malibu home in the Woolsey Fire.
